Esthetics Certificates and Degrees

cucumber mask Mill Neck NY esthetics clientThere are primarily two avenues offered to get esthetician training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s generally take 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in each of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are offered if you prefer to specialize in just one area, for instance esthetics. A degree program will also probably include management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to manage a salon or other Mill Neck NY business. More advanced deg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specializations as salon or spa management. Whichever type of training program you go with, it’s important to make certain that it’s certified by the New York Board of Cosmetology. Many states only approve schools that are accredited by certain reputable agencies, such as the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Esthetician Classes

Online esthetician schools are accommodating for Mill Neck NY students who are employed full-time and have family commitments that make it difficult to enroll in a more traditional school. There are many online cosmetology school programs available that can be attended through a personal comput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More conventional cosmetology schools are often fast paced because many programs are as short as 6 or 8 months. This means that a considerable portion of time is spent in the classroom. With internet programs, you are dealing with the same amount of material, but you’re not devoting many hours outside of your home or commuting to and from classes. However, it’s important that the school you pick can provide internship training in nearby salons and parlors so that you also obtain the hands-on training required for a comprehensive education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s impossible to gain the skills necessary to work in any facet of the cosmetology industry. So be sure if you decide to enroll in an online program to confirm that internship training is available in your area.

Is the School Accredited? It’s essential to make certain that the esthetician college you select is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ards assuring a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be essential for obtaining student loans or financial aid, which often are not available in 11765 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a criteria for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, a number of Mill Neck NY businesses will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more favorably upon those with accredited training.

Is Enough Hands-On Training Provided?  Practicing and perfecting esthetician skills and techniques involves lots of practice on volunteers. Check how much live, hands-on training is furnished in the beauty courses you will be attending. Some schools have salons on campus that make it possible for students to practice their developing talents on real people. If a beauty program offers little or no scheduled live training, but rather depends mainly on utilizing mannequins, it might not be the best alternative for cultivating your skills. So look for alternate schools that offer this type of training.

    Mill Neck, New York

    According to the United States Census Bureau, the village has a total area of 2.9 square miles (7.5 km2), of which, 2.6 square miles (6.7 km2) of it is land and 0.3 square miles (0.78 km2) of it (11.95%) is water.

    As of the census[4] of 2000, there were 825 people, 295 households, and 241 families residing in the village. The population density was 319.8 people per square mile (123.5/km²). There were 326 housing units at an average density of 126.4 per square mile (48.8/km²). The racial makeup of the village was 92.00% White, 0.24% African American, 4.73% Asian, 2.42% from other races, and 0.61%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 5.58% of the population.

    There were 295 households out of which 34.6%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 74.9% were married couples living together, 5.8% had a female householder with no husband present, and 18.0% were non-families. 13.6% of all households were made up of individuals and 6.4%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.80 and the average family size was 3.07.
